6:20 — The Eagles officially announced they are cutting eight players, including veteran wide receivers Chris Givens and Rueben RandleAndrew GardnerMike MartinRandall EvansDenzel RiceNick Perry, and John DePalma were also waived.

Joe Walker and Alex McCalister were both placed on the Injured Reserve list. The roster currently stands at 73 players.

2:55 — The Eagles released Chris Givens, according to NFL Network’s Rand Getlin. Assuming Philadelphia places Joe Walker on the Injured Reserve list, they still need to cut seven more players so they have 75 players on the roster by Tuesday’s 4 p.m. deadline.

The Eagles agreed to a one-year deal with Givens in March for a reported $840,000. According to Over the Cap, cutting Givens will cut the Eagles $180,000 in dead money.
